BD06 XCS is a 2006 Jaguar X-type in Blue with a 2,198cc diesel engine. This vehicle has been through 21 MOT tests with a personal pass rate of 76.2%.
Across all 2006 Jaguar X-type models, the average MOT pass rate is 74.2% with a typical mileage of 86,173 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Jaguar X-type f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 68,260 recorded failures. If you're considering buying BD06 XCS, it's worth having these areas checked by a mechanic before committing.
The Jaguar X-type typically stays on UK roads for around 25 years. At 20 years old, this Jaguar X-type is approaching the upper end of the typical lifespan for this model.
